Abstract

That will allow the accomplishment of multiple tasks in the same operation; that is, clearing of the sugarcane stalk; unpacking of the soil between the rows of sugarcane sowing; fertilization of both sides of the cane, raw or burnt, and the application of phytosanitary products, liquid and / or solid and / or other microgranulates, and where the distribution of these products will be automatically regulated by electronic controller, operating with fixed or variable dosage rates, according to the agronomic conditions of the worked area.
